The Dockside Tavern is located in Port Adelaide on the corner of Lipson Street and McLaren Parade and also has frontage to Menpes Street.
The premises comprise a two storey hotel built circa 1898 and provides a central front bar, dining, gaming area, rear kitchen and yard. There are 10 accommodation rooms to the upper level.

The size of Port Adelaide is approximately 6.0 square kilometres. There are 7 parks, covering nearly 3.2% of the total area. The population of Port Adelaide in 2016 was 1224 people. By 2021 the population was 1338 showing a population growth of 9.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Port Adelaide is 60-69 years. Households in Port Adelaide are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Port Adelaide work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 43.20% of the homes in Port Adelaide were owner-occupied compared with 43.00% in 2016.
